Passer au contenu principal

Tableau de bord des événements

Le shortcode `[event_scoreboard]` affiche un tableau de bord de style ticker à défilement horizontal montrant les événements avec les noms d'équipes et les scores ou les horaires programmés. Chaque carte d'événement a une largeur fixe et les utilisa…

Mis à jour aujourd’hui

Tableau de bord des événements

Le shortcode [event_scoreboard] affiche un tableau de bord de style ticker à défilement horizontal montrant les événements avec les noms d'équipes et les scores ou les horaires programmés. Chaque carte d'événement a une largeur fixe et les utilisateurs peuvent défiler gauche/droite à travers les événements.

Nécessite SportsPress Pro. Le module Tableau de bord doit être activé (Réglages > Événements > Tableau de bord).

Ce qu'il affiche

Une rangée de cartes d'événements défilable. Chaque carte affiche optionnellement la date, l'heure, la ligue, la saison et les métadonnées de lieu en haut, suivies des noms d'équipes (avec logos optionnels) et leurs scores ou horaire programmé. Des boutons de défilement de chaque côté permettent aux utilisateurs de naviguer à travers les événements.

Quand l'utiliser

Utilisez sur n'importe quelle page, article ou widget. Il peut également être placé sur l'ensemble du site via le réglage Tableau de bord en en-tête (le tableau de bord en en-tête utilise le réglage de limite global). Avec id il filtre sur un Calendrier spécifique ; sans id il interroge tous les événements.

Paramètres

Paramètre

Type

Défaut

Description

id

entier

null

ID de publication du Calendrier SportsPress à afficher.

status

chaîne

'default'

Filtre de statut d'événement : 'default', 'future', 'publish'.

date

chaîne

'default'

Préréglage de date. Lorsque id n'est pas défini, la valeur par défaut est 'auto' (passé et futur autour d'aujourd'hui).

date_from

chaîne

'default'

Début de la plage de dates (AAAA-MM-JJ).

date_to

chaîne

'default'

Fin de la plage de dates (AAAA-MM-JJ).

date_past

chaîne

'default'

Jours dans le passé à inclure.

date_future

chaîne

'default'

Jours dans le futur à inclure.

date_relative

chaîne

'default'

Mode de date relative.

day

chaîne

'default'

Filtre de journée de match.

league

entier/chaîne

null

ID ou slug de terme de ligue.

season

entier/chaîne

null

ID ou slug de terme de saison.

date_format

chaîne

Depuis les réglages

Format de date PHP pour l'affichage de la date. Par défaut depuis le réglage Tableau de bord > Format de date (M j).

number

entier

-1

Nombre maximum d'événements à afficher. -1 affiche tous.

width

entier

Depuis les réglages

Largeur en pixels de chaque carte d'événement. Par défaut depuis le réglage Tableau de bord > Largeur (180).

step

entier

Depuis les réglages

Nombre d'événements à défiler par clic. Par défaut depuis le réglage Tableau de bord > Défilement (2).

show_team_logo

booléen

Depuis les réglages

1 pour afficher les logos d'équipes. Par défaut depuis le réglage Tableau de bord > Afficher les logos.

link_events

booléen

Depuis les réglages

1 pour lier les cartes d'événements aux pages d'événements.

order

chaîne

'default'

Ordre de tri : 'ASC' ou 'DESC'.

show_all_events_link

booléen

false

1 pour afficher un lien « Voir tous les événements » (nécessite id).

show_date

booléen

Depuis les réglages

1 pour afficher la date de l'événement dans chaque carte.

show_time

booléen

Depuis les réglages

1 pour afficher l'heure de l'événement dans chaque carte. Par défaut true.

show_league

booléen

Depuis les réglages

1 pour afficher la ligue dans chaque carte.

show_season

booléen

Depuis les réglages

1 pour afficher la saison dans chaque carte.

show_venue

booléen

Depuis les réglages

1 pour afficher le lieu dans chaque carte.

Exemples d'utilisation

Minimal — tableau de bord depuis un calendrier spécifique :

[event_scoreboard id="30"]

Tableau de bord pour tous les événements d'une ligue, avec logos et heure affichés, défilant 3 à la fois :

[event_scoreboard league="5" show_team_logo="1" show_time="1" step="3"]

Tableau de bord affichant les 10 événements les plus récents ou à venir, avec date sans heure :

[event_scoreboard number="10" show_date="1" show_time="0"]

Avez-vous trouvé la réponse à votre question ?